Government backs second chances

Deputy Prime Minister and Minister for Finance, Professor Biman Prasad, has reaffirmed the government’s commitment to supporting the welfare and rehabilitation of incarcerated individuals. Speaking to hundreds of participants at the Fiji Corrections Service Yellow Ribbon Walk in Nausori this morning, Prasad said the program builds the foundation for safer communities, unlocks human potential, and […]
